Who can apply for a 100% mortgage?
You could be eligible if:
- You’re a first-time buyer
- You can show a track record of paying rent and household bills (such as gas, electricity, water rates and council tax) for at least 12 consecutive months within the last 18 months.
- You meet Skipton’s household-to-household criteria (the same people who have been renting now, and have been for the past 12-months, are the same people applying for the mortgage)
- Your loan amount is no more than £600,000
- You have no missed payments on credit commitments (e.g. credit cards, loans) in the last six months
- You are not purchasing a new-build apartment, this mortgage is available on new-build homes only
